Hey Shannon....I was thinking about you yesterday and wondering where you've been.  Labs make great pets, my sister had two chocolates, both died over the last few months.  They were very old though.  One thing about them you should know....read up about preventing bloat.  Both my sister's dogs got it.  One survived and lived several years after the surgery, the other had to be put down.  Anyway, I guess it's fairly common in labs more than in many other breeds (still rare though) but something you should know about.
